1 Samuel 25:32
And David said to Abigail, Blessed be the Lord God of Israel, which sent thee this day to meet me:
Context
This verse from 1 Samuel Chapter 25 connects to 8 cross-references. Samuel dies and is buried at Ramah. David asks wealthy Nabal to provide for his men who had protected Nabal's flocks; Nabal harshly refuses. David marches to kill Nabal's household; Nabal's wise wife Abigail intercepts David with generous provisions and …
